MO SCR40
Concurrent Resolution
AI Summary
- Ratifies the Equal Rights Amendment to the United States Constitution, which prohibits denial or abridgement of equality of rights under law on account of sex
- Acknowledges the amendment was passed by Congress on March 22, 1972, and sent to states for ratification with a deadline of June 30, 1982
- Notes that 35 states ratified the amendment before the deadline and questions whether Congress had constitutional authority to impose a ratification deadline
- Directs the Secretary of the Senate to send copies of the resolution to the U.S. Archivist, Vice President, Speaker of the House, and Missouri's Congressional delegation for printing in the Congressional Record
- Finds the amendment meaningful and needed, asserting that current political, social, and economic conditions support ratification
